Historic flight

Air Force Secretary Michael W. Wynne speaks during the first C-17 Synthetic Fuel Transcontinental Flight ceremony here Dec. 17. Left to right, Maj. Gen. Frederick Roggero, director of air, space and information operations, Kevin Billings, deputy assistant secretary of the Air Force for environment, safety and health, and Col. Balan Ayyar, 305th Air Mobility Wing commander, were also guest speakers during the event. The aircraft from McChord AFB, Wash., powered by a 50/50 blend of synthetic fuel and JP-8, landed here on the anniversary of the Wright Brothers’ first flight, 104 years ago. The transcontinental flight was a demonstration of the fuel being used to certify the entire Air Force fleet including ground vehicles. (U.S. Air Force courtesy photo)
